Abstract
Photoionization measurements on potassium clusters, KN, with 3 ≤N ≤101 atoms, show the influence of the clusters' electronic shell structure throughout the range of cluster sizes. Steps in the photoionization thresholds at the major shell closings are observed, and features in the photoionization spectra are correlated with the clusters' electronic levels. The trend of the thresholds toward the bulk work function is also observed.
